Output 33d1a24a9bf85891cfc0707e50b4a8e22ffb16065cbc66ce263a93f5e1e2dfce:0

value
344915
script pubkey
OP_0 OP_PUSHBYTES_20 4dce4ed484ba9f52d085a0981cd51e79a5d55d5c
address
bc1qfh8ya4yyh20495y95zvpe4g70xja2h2uyskaea
transaction
33d1a24a9bf85891cfc0707e50b4a8e22ffb16065cbc66ce263a93f5e1e2dfce
confirmations
17602
spent
true